Here's a possible solution to your lens stop problem. I have a 65 Optar (not that great a lens) which normally rests right on the crack of the bed when in proper position. The other day I wanted to use the drop bed with it so I could use some rise with the lens.

I happen to have a second set of stops which sit slightly recessed on the front board. By using a square spacer I was able to set the lens placement squarely in the rear by using these forward stops, drop the bed and then focus on the ground glass.

You should be able to accomplish the same thing with your 47. Put a set of infinity stops up front then use a spacer to set the lens board square in the rear. This consistency should allow you to make a distance scale to match the lens.
